Transaction 16754fc89846481da7e76face7f41d1c7f0c8298baa339a82578750b78e997c8
1 Input
1 Output
-
16754fc89846481da7e76face7f41d1c7f0c8298baa339a82578750b78e997c8:0
- value
- 132359558
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07f504b3256a9ca49cb9468d9c1212614fd06a1d OP_EQUAL
- address
- 32R6B4U29brZ4Wq1Pat38Cwupq4TiQVX5i